Ingestion: May be harmful if swallowed. Aspiration of the material into the lungs can cause chemical pneumonitis,
which can be fatal.
Carcinogen: Contains trace amounts of Ethyl Benzene (<0.075% of total formulation by weight), which is considered
a carcinogen by IARC. It has caused cancer in laboratory animals. The relevance of these findings to humans is
uncertain.
Aggravation of Pre-existing Conditions: Persons with pre-existing skin, eye, or lung disorders may be more
susceptible to the effects of the substance.

Section 13 Disposal Information
Waste Disposal Method: Liquid material is an ignitable waste (D001). Dispose of material in accordance with all
Federal, State, and Local regulations.
Section 14 Transport Information
Proper Shipping Name: Paint
Hazard Class: 3
UN: UN1263
Packing Group: PGIII
Marine Pollutant: No
Non-regulated Material in containers <119 gallons for ground shipments.
